Objective
The chief or assistant chief flight instructor will conduct this
lesson. The student will be evaluated on their readiness to take the
flight instructor rotorcraft/helicopter practical test
Elements
Air Work
- Preflight procedures (A of O V)
- Preflight inspection
- Cockpit management
- Engine starting and rotor engagement
- Before takeoff check
- Hovering Maneuvers (A of O VII)
- Vertical takeoff and landing
- Surface taxi
- Hover taxi
- Slope operation
- Takeoff, Landing and Go-Around (A of O VIII)
- Normal and crosswind takeoff and climb
- Max. performance takeoff and climb
- Rolling takeoff
- Normal and crosswind approach
- Steep approach
- Shallow approach and run-on landing
- Go-around
- Fundamentals of Flight (A of O IX)
- Straight and level flight
- Level turns
- Straight climb and climbing turns
- Straight descents and descending turns
- Performance Maneuvers (A of O X)
- Rapid deceleration
- Straight-in autorotation
- 180 degree autorotation
- Emergency Operations (A of O XI)
- Power failure at a hover
- Power failure at altitude
- Settling with power
- Low RPM recovery
- Anti-torque system failure
- Systems and equipment malfunctions (in-flight oral)
- Special Operations
- Task -- Confined Operation

Completion Standards
The student has demonstrated from the flight test that they meet
the acceptable performance standards of the applicable areas of the
flight instructor helicopter practical test.
